Eingabe über stdin: Format: n,knumerix hat geschrieben:Mit allem drum und dran? Eingabe und Ausgabe über stdin/stdout?
Oder nur eine Funktion noverk(n,k)?
Ausgabe stdout
Ich meine gelesen zu haben, dass der Java-Compiler einen Obfuscator anwendet... Hab mich wohl verlesen. Vielen Dank, dass du mich aufgeklärt hast Haben wir uns wohl gegenseitig in diesem Thread aufgeklärtBlackJack hat geschrieben:@BlackVivi: Bei Java sind die Variablennamen fast alle noch da, es sei denn man macht aktiv etwas dagegen, in dem man zum Beispiel "Obfuscator"-Programme von Drittanbietern drüber laufen lässt.
Nur lokale Namen in Methoden sind in der Regel weg, an ``private``-Namen kommt man aber dran.
Ja, ich habs selbst versucht, aber auf die Idee mit dem Debugger bin ich nicht gekommen. "Viel zu lernen du noch hast" wäre das Motto für mich heute.Crackus hat geschrieben:krass ich hab zwar nur die hälfte verstanden aber echt krass^^
Und wo ist C an dieser Stelle sicherer. Hast du schonmal überlegt, wie Cracker vorgehen? Viele von den gecrackten Programmen sind in C geschrieben. Sogar solche die aufwendiger geschützt sind als sich nur auf Binärcode in dem der Algorithmus versteckt ist zu stützen.Crackus hat geschrieben:okay das heißt wenn man etwas wirklich "geheim" halten will sollte man noch C lernen
Wo hat Geheimhaltung von Code was mit der optimalen Nutzbarkeit von einer Programmiersprache zu tun? Sieh es ein: wenn du nicht schon Schutz auf der Hardware implementierst, wie einige Konsolen das machen hast du überhaupt keine Chance deine Geheimnisse in inrgenwelchen Binärdateien zu verstecken. Ein talentierter, motivierter Angreifer wird dahinterkommen, siehe auch die Konsolen-Hacks.Crackus hat geschrieben:um Python optimal gebrauchen zu können